How to increase the number 8 by 3,208.2% percent of its value?
Value of Percentage Increase. New Value
- A percentage value is nothing but a fraction with a denominator of 100:
- 3,208.2% = 3,208.2/100 = 3,208.2 ÷ 100 = 32.082
- To increase a positive number add the 'Value of Percentage Increase' to it.
- To increase a negative number, don't add to it, but subtract from it the 'Value of Percentage Increase'.
